Seatrade Maritime · Global · VLCC Kiku struck in Strait of Hormuz, UKMTO raises threat level to 'substantial'
Reports the Kiku strike with technical detail: 300,866 dwt VLCC, 2 million barrels cargo, bridge damaged, all crew safe, no pollution. Notes this is Iran's third attack on commercial vessels since the US-Iran MoU was signed June 17, following the Singapore-flagged Ever Lovely on June 25.
